Runbook: account recovery for Pellarin canary gating. Canary deploys are blocked unless error budget remains above 98% and the gating account is in good standing. If the gating account is locked after repeated promotion failures, do not bypass the gate; instead, recover the account through the Pellarin console. The console will reject standard credentials in recovery mode and ask for the recovery passphrase, which for auditability we record directly below this paragraph.

strongbox words: istwyn-normir-silwyn-ulaius-istwyn

## Step 4: Update solver bindings

Plugin authors migrating to Chronoply 3.x must replace the deprecated `SlotResolver` interface with `PeriodResolver`, which accepts room-capacity constraints directly. Validate your plugin against the Ashfell sample timetable before publishing. Note that the solver now reads constraint weights from configuration rather than code; the defaults are shown below.

config for kafof-bawef:
holath:
  log_level: debug
  metrics_host: metrics.holath.qorvelsys.internal
  pin: 2191
  pool_size: 32

### Step 4: Enable the circuit breaker for the Quillmont upstream API

Before cutting traffic over, enable the breaker in the Harrowgate gateway so that failures from Quillmont's pricing endpoint trip after the configured error-rate threshold rather than cascading into retries. Note for security review: the breaker's open state returns a cached, sanitized response and never echoes upstream error bodies. Verify the half-open probe interval against your audit baseline. The relevant configuration values follow below.

settings of bawif-fawif:
ralix:
  log_level: warn
  metrics_host: metrics.ralix.tolvaqsys.internal
  pool_size: 32

☐ Pop-up office setup at the Marstenholm Trade Fair. Reception staff on rotation should arrive at Hall C by 08:00 and unlock the Quillbright Solutions stand units before exhibitors arrive. Check that the visitor sign-in tablet is charged, the branded lanyards are stocked, and the meeting pod booking sheet is printed. Deliveries come through the east service corridor; sign for them at the stand, not the hall office. Access to the pop-up storage locker requires the badge code provided below.

turnstile pass: bdg-YPPQB-52010